Compatibility Notes
Compatible with Shimano, Tektro, and TRP disc brake calipers. Organic compound works best with standard steel rotors. Do not use with carbon rotors. Rotor size (140mm, 160mm, or 180mm) does not affect pad fitment — only caliper model matters. Replace pads before compound wears to the metal backing plate to prevent rotor damage.

How do I know if these pads fit my brake calipers?
These pads fit Shimano, Tektro, and TRP disc brake calipers. Check the caliper body for a model number — it is usually embossed or printed on the side. If your calipers are SRAM or Magura, these pads will not fit. When in doubt, contact Cobbled Climbs with your caliper model and we can confirm compatibility before you order.
Will organic brake pads hold up in India's monsoon and heat?
Organic pads perform well in wet monsoon conditions, offering consistent modulation on rain-slicked roads in Mumbai or Kolkata. In extreme 35°C+ summer heat, organic compound can fade slightly faster than sintered pads on very long descents. For typical Indian road and trail riding they are entirely adequate — just inspect them more frequently during monsoon months when contamination risk is higher.
How do organic disc brake pads compare to sintered pads?
Organic pads bed in quicker, run quieter, and offer better initial bite and modulation at moderate temperatures. Sintered pads last longer, handle sustained heat better on long descents like Ooty or Khandala, but can be noisier and harder on rotors. For most Indian road riders and casual trail riders, organic compound is the more comfortable daily choice.
